Output 187838c6d8d29615a6fab8f18bd8ddc1f7782e31211022fe6a4307dddb33a77f:0

value
2659933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955fd3eab58979d0e810f7b2feac096c8a4e270b OP_EQUAL
address
3FJqQMm9B3GpAGZdibdgvXJMcPenUoppYw
transaction
187838c6d8d29615a6fab8f18bd8ddc1f7782e31211022fe6a4307dddb33a77f